SkuNexus eCommerce Fulfillment, eCommerce Guide, eCommerce Strategy, Order Management

Embrace the Future with Headless eCommerce: A Deep Dive into Headless Commerce Platforms

Benefits of Headless Commerce

 

 

Headless Commerce Platforms: An Overview

What is Headless Commerce?

Headless Commerce means building and managing online stores by decoupling the front and backend systems. This decoupled commerce system can help businesses to create unique, responsive, and scalable customer experiences through the use of headless APIs. By separating the user interface (aka presentation layer) from the underlying eCommerce system infrastructure, companies gain the flexibility to develop and iterate front-end designs without interfering with the back-end processes.

Evolution and Growth of Headless Commerce Platforms

The evolution of headless eCommerce can be traced back to the growing need for greater adaptability in the rapidly changing digital landscape. Traditional eCommerce platforms, based on monolithic architecture, have often been restrictive, making it challenging for businesses to customize their online stores and adapt to emerging technologies. As eCommerce brands started to recognize the benefits of decoupled systems, using headless commerce began to gain momentum.

Importance and Relevance of Going Headless in 2023 

In today's market, headless eCommerce has become increasingly relevant due to several key factors. The rise of mobile devices and the diversification of customer touchpoints (headless storefront, eCommerce sites, native apps, etc.) have made it essential for eCommerce businesses to deliver seamless and consistent experiences across channels. A custom headless solution allows companies to develop tailor-made solutions that cater to the unique needs of each platform, including web, mobile, social media, and emerging technologies such as voice assistants and virtual reality.

As consumer expectations for personalized and engaging shopping experiences with eCommerce stores have surged, online retailers must continually innovate and adapt their digital presence. Headless storefronts foster rapid experimentation and implementation of new features, designs, and functionalities, thereby enabling businesses to stay ahead of the competition.

The increasing emphasis on performance and site speed has further underscored the need for efficient and optimized eCommerce solutions. By leveraging the headless approach, businesses can ensure faster loading times, better SEO, and improved overall user experience, ultimately leading to higher conversion rates and customer satisfaction.

Understanding the Architecture of Headless eCommerce Solutions

Lack of Flexibility Hampers the Traditional Commerce System

Monolithic architecture: Monolithic eCommerce platforms comprise a single, unified architecture in which the frontend and backend systems are tightly integrated. These platforms have been the standard in the eCommerce industry for many years, offering businesses an out-of-the-box solution to manage their online stores. Monolithic architectures typically provide a standardized set of features and templates, facilitating straightforward deployment and maintenance. However, as the digital landscape has evolved, the limitations of these traditional platforms have become increasingly apparent.

Limitations of traditional platforms: The primary limitation of monolithic eCommerce legacy platforms is their inflexibility. Due to the tightly-coupled nature of these systems, any modification or update to the frontend requires changes to the backend as well. This often leads to a slower development process, increased complexity, diminished commerce functionality, and potential disruptions to the entire system. Additionally, traditional platforms tend to offer limited customization options, making it challenging for businesses to create unique and engaging customer eCommerce experiences. These platforms may also hinder adaptability to emerging technologies and channels, potentially putting companies at a competitive disadvantage.

Headless Commerce vs. Traditional eCommerce Models

Decoupled architecture: Unlike traditional commerce platforms, headless eCommerce adopts a decoupled architecture, separating the frontend (presentation layer) from the backend (eCommerce infrastructure). This approach allows businesses to manage their online stores using APIs, which facilitate communication between the frontend and backend systems. By breaking down the barriers between these two components, headless platforms enable greater flexibility, customization, and scalability for online retailers.

Benefits of headless platforms: Using a headless eCommerce platform offers several advantages over traditional monolithic systems. Firstly, they provide greater flexibility and customization, allowing businesses to create bespoke customer experiences tailored to their target audience. This can result in increased customer engagement, higher conversion rates, and improved brand loyalty. Secondly, the decoupled architecture enables faster development and iteration, allowing businesses to adapt quickly to market trends and provide a faster time to market of new features without disrupting the entire system. Thirdly, headless technology facilitates seamless integration with emerging technologies and channels, ensuring that businesses can continually innovate and stay ahead of the competition. Lastly, the performance benefits of headless eCommerce, such as faster loading times and improved SEO, contribute to a superior user experience, which can translate into higher customer satisfaction and increased revenue.

Key Components of Headless eCommerce Platforms

Backend Systems in Headless Architecture: Unlocking Seamless Integration and Scalability

Content management system (CMS): A headless Content Management System (CMS) allows businesses to efficiently create, manage, and distribute content across various digital channels. By decoupling the content layer from the presentation layer, a headless CMS enables greater flexibility and customization in the way content is displayed. This ensures a consistent and personalized user experience across multiple devices and touchpoints. Moreover, the CMS empowers non-technical users to manage content without relying on developers.

Product information management (PIM): In a headless eCommerce architecture, the product information management (PIM) system serves as a centralized repository for all product data. This includes product descriptions, images, pricing, and inventory details. PIM systems enable businesses to manage and update product information efficiently, ensuring that accurate and consistent data is displayed across all customer touchpoints.

Order management system (OMS): The order management system (OMS) handles the entire order lifecycle, from order placement to fulfillment and returns. By streamlining and automating key processes, such as payment processing, shipping, and order tracking, the OMS plays a crucial role in optimizing the backend operations of a headless commerce platform.

Customer relationship management (CRM): Customer relationship management (CRM) systems are essential for managing customer data and interactions throughout the customer journey. To optimize eCommerce functionality, the CRM system is integrated with other backend systems, allowing businesses to deliver personalized marketing campaigns, provide targeted product recommendations, and enhance overall customer satisfaction.

The API Creates Critical Connections in a Headless eCommerce Platform

RESTful APIs: Representational State Transfer (RESTful) APIs are widely used in headless commerce systems for their simplicity and scalability. These APIs facilitate communication between your eCommerce website frontend and backend systems, allowing developers to access and manipulate data without disrupting the underlying infrastructure.

GraphQL APIs: GraphQL is a query language and runtime for APIs, offering increased flexibility and efficiency compared to RESTful APIs. GraphQL allows developers to request only the specific data they need, reducing data transfer and improving the overall performance of a headless commerce platform.

API-first approach: An API-first approach prioritizes the development and optimization of APIs in the initial stages of building a headless commerce platform. By focusing on API design and functionality early on, businesses can ensure seamless integration between the frontend and backend systems, fostering a more efficient and adaptable platform.

Frontend Systems in a Headless eCommerce Solution: Crafting Exceptional User Experiences

Responsive web design: Responsive web design enables a headless system to deliver a consistent and engaging user experience across various devices and screen sizes. By automatically adjusting the layout and design based on the user's device, responsive web design ensures optimal usability and accessibility.

Progressive web apps (PWAs): Progressive web apps (PWAs) combine the best features of web and mobile applications, providing a fast, reliable, and engaging user experience. PWAs can be installed on a user's device, enabling offline access, push notifications, and other native app-like functionality, further enhancing the customer experience.

Mobile applications: Mobile applications are an integral component of many headless commerce platforms, offering a tailored user experience and additional features not available on web-based platforms. Mobile apps can leverage device-specific capabilities, such as location services and biometric authentication, to create a seamless and personalized shopping experience.

Advantages of Headless Commerce Platforms

Get Greater Flexibility with Headless Commerce Architecture

Customization capabilities: A switch to headless provides businesses with the freedom to create unique and bespoke customer experiences, unbound by the constraints of traditional monolithic systems. This enables retailers to tailor their online stores to meet the specific needs of their target audience, fostering increased engagement and conversions.

Independent scaling of frontend and backend: The decoupled nature of a headless model allows businesses to scale their frontend and backend systems independently, ensuring optimal performance and resource allocation.

Headless Platforms Dramatically Improve Performance

Faster loading times: Headless commerce can help deliver content quickly and efficiently, resulting in faster loading times and a more responsive user experience.

Better SEO: The improved performance and optimized architecture of headless commerce platforms can lead to better search engine optimization (SEO), driving increased organic traffic and visibility.

Enhance Customer Experiences with a Headless Commerce Solution

Omnichannel retailing: Headless commerce gives support to omnichannel retailing, enabling businesses to offer a seamless and consistent customer experience across all touchpoints, including websites, mobile apps, social media, and physical stores. This holistic approach to customer engagement fosters brand loyalty and drives repeat business.

Personalized shopping experiences: By leveraging customer data from backend systems, such as CRM and PIM, headless commerce platforms can deliver highly personalized shopping experiences. This includes tailored product recommendations, targeted promotions, and dynamic content, all of which contribute to higher conversion rates and increased customer satisfaction.

Stay Ahead of the Curve with the Adaptability and Future-Proofing Benefits of Headless Commerce

Technology and platform agnostic: Headless commerce platforms are technology and platform agnostic, meaning they can easily integrate with existing and emerging technologies. This allows businesses to select the best tools and solutions for their specific needs, without being locked into a particular technology stack or ecosystem.

Integrating emerging technologies: The flexibility and modular nature of headless commerce platforms make it easier for businesses to adopt and integrate emerging technologies, such as augmented reality, artificial intelligence, and the Internet of Things. This capability allows businesses to stay at the forefront of innovation and maintain a competitive edge in the ever-evolving digital landscape.

Real-World Examples of Headless Commerce Platform Success

Large retail brand

Challenges faced: A well-established retail brand faced challenges in managing its extensive product catalog, delivering a consistent omnichannel experience, and keeping up with the ever-evolving demands of its customer base. The brand's existing monolithic eCommerce platform limited customization capabilities and hindered the ability to adapt and innovate quickly.

Headless commerce platform implementation: The retail brand chose to transition to a headless commerce platform, which allowed for seamless integration with its existing systems, such as PIM, OMS, and CRM. The decoupled architecture enabled the company to independently update and customize the frontend and backend, ensuring a consistent and engaging experience across all channels.

Results achieved: By implementing a headless commerce platform, the retail brand saw significant improvements in website performance, resulting in faster loading times and better SEO rankings. The enhanced customization capabilities allowed the brand to create personalized shopping experiences for its customers, driving increased engagement and conversion rates. Additionally, the brand was able to streamline its backend operations, resulting in cost savings and improved efficiency.

Small business

Challenges faced: A small business specializing in niche products faced difficulties in scaling its online presence, as its traditional eCommerce platform could not keep up with the rapidly changing market demands. The business struggled to offer a mobile-responsive website, maintain a consistent brand identity, and manage an increasing number of product offerings.

Headless commerce platform implementation: The small business opted for a headless commerce platform that provided the flexibility and scalability needed to grow its online presence. The platform's API-first approach allowed for seamless integration with the company's existing systems and facilitated the development of a mobile-responsive website, as well as a mobile app to reach a wider audience.

Results achieved: With the headless commerce platform in place, the small business experienced improved website performance, including faster loading times and enhanced mobile responsiveness. The company was able to create a unified brand experience across all customer touchpoints, leading to increased customer satisfaction and loyalty. Additionally, the headless platform enabled the business to efficiently manage its growing product catalog and adapt to market trends, positioning it for continued growth and success.

Challenges and Considerations in Adopting Headless Commerce Platforms

Technical Complexity 

Development expertise: Adopting a headless commerce platform often requires a higher level of development expertise compared to traditional monolithic platforms. Businesses need to have access to skilled developers familiar with frontend frameworks, API integrations, and backend systems in order to build and maintain a successful headless implementation.

Integration with existing systems: Integrating a headless commerce platform with existing systems, such as CRMs, ERPs, and payment gateways, can be complex and time-consuming. Ensuring seamless communication between various components and maintaining data consistency across different systems is crucial for the success of a headless commerce implementation.

Cost Implications Must Always Be Taken into Consideration

Initial investment: The initial investment required to adopt a headless commerce platform can be higher than that of traditional platforms, due to the need for custom development and integration work. However, this investment can pay off in the long run, as headless platforms provide greater flexibility, scalability, and future-proofing.

Ongoing maintenance and support: Headless commerce platforms may require more ongoing maintenance and support compared to traditional platforms, as they involve a higher level of customization and complexity. Businesses should be prepared to invest in dedicated resources, either in-house or through outsourced partners, to ensure the smooth operation of their headless commerce platform.

Security and Compliance Issues are Potential Drawbacks of Headless Commerce Platforms

Data privacy: As headless commerce platforms rely on APIs to transfer data between systems, it is crucial to ensure data privacy and compliance with relevant regulations, such as the General Data Protection Regulation (GDPR) and the California Consumer Privacy Act (CCPA). Businesses must implement robust data protection measures and keep up-to-date with evolving privacy regulations to maintain customer trust and avoid potential fines.

API security best practices: Securing APIs is a critical aspect of maintaining a headless commerce platform, as they serve as the primary communication channels between frontend and backend systems. Businesses should follow API security best practices, such as implementing access controls, encrypting data in transit, and regularly monitoring and auditing API usage, to minimize the risk of security breaches and unauthorized access.

Tips for Selecting the Best Headless eCommerce Platform in 2023 and Beyond

Key Features to Consider to Get Started with Headless

API capabilities: When choosing a platform, it's crucial to evaluate the API-first headless commerce capabilities it offers. Look for platforms that provide a comprehensive set of APIs, support for modern API standards such as RESTful and GraphQL, and extensive documentation to make integration and development easier.

Extensibility and customization: A key advantage of headless commerce is the ability to create unique, tailored experiences for customers. Ensure the platform you select offers robust extensibility and customization options, including support for various frontend frameworks and the ability to integrate with third-party tools and services.

Scalability and performance: For long-term success, it's essential to choose a platform that can scale with your business as it grows. Look for platforms that offer high-performance infrastructure, support for content delivery networks (CDNs), and the ability to independently scale frontend and backend systems to maintain optimal performance.

Security and compliance: Assess the platform's security features, ensuring it adheres to industry best practices and complies with data privacy regulations. Consider the platform's approach to API security and its ability to integrate with your existing security solutions.

Ease of integration: Examine the platform's ability to integrate seamlessly with your existing systems and technology stack, as well as its compatibility with popular third-party services and tools, to minimize the complexity of implementation.

Support and documentation: Consider the level of support and resources provided by the platform, including access to a knowledgeable support team, comprehensive documentation, and an active developer community to help you overcome any challenges during implementation and ongoing maintenance.

Best Practices for Implementing Headless Commerce Platforms

The Best Headless eCommerce Platforms Demand the Right Team

In-house vs. outsourced: When implementing a headless commerce platform, consider whether to build your team in-house or outsource to an experienced agency. In-house teams provide better control over the development process and seamless collaboration. However, outsourcing can be a cost-effective option, offering access to a diverse range of expertise and reducing the need for extensive in-house training.

Required skill sets: The successful implementation of a headless commerce platform requires a range of skill sets, including frontend and backend developers, UX/UI designers, project managers, and data specialists. Ensure your team has the necessary expertise in API integrations, modern frontend frameworks, and backend systems to create a seamless and efficient headless commerce experience.

Create a Phased Implementation Plan for Entering the Headless eCommerce Space

Setting goals and milestones: Establish clear goals and milestones for your headless commerce implementation to help guide the project and measure success. Set realistic timelines, taking into consideration factors such as platform selection, team resources, and the complexity of integrations.

Prioritizing features and functionality: To manage the scope of your implementation, prioritize the features and functionality most critical to your business's success. Focus on delivering the highest-impact improvements first, and plan for additional enhancements in subsequent phases of the project.

Keeping Your eCommerce Platform Options Flexible Helps Ensure Ongoing Success

Monitoring and optimization: Continuously monitor the performance of your headless commerce platform, paying close attention to key performance indicators (KPIs) such as loading times, conversion rates, and user engagement. Regularly review and optimize your frontend and backend systems to ensure optimal performance and user experience.

Continuous innovation: Headless eCommerce systems provide a flexible foundation for ongoing innovation. Stay informed about emerging technologies and industry trends, and be prepared to integrate new solutions and features into your platform as needed. By maintaining a focus on continuous improvement, your eCommerce team can stay competitive and adapt to the ever-evolving digital landscape.

Go Headless with SkuNexus!

The flexible and customizable architecture of SkuNexus enterprise software makes it an ideal choice for integration within a headless commerce platform. With a robust set of APIs, SkuNexus allows for seamless connectivity with multiple platforms and front-end frameworks, enabling businesses to customize their eCommerce customer experiences while maintaining a high level of performance.

SkuNexus's extensible design allows it to adapt to the unique needs of each business, facilitating the integration of third-party tools and services to enhance functionality and streamline workflows. This adaptability ensures that businesses can stay agile and respond to the ever-evolving eCommerce landscape, maximizing their competitive advantage.

By incorporating SkuNexus with a headless commerce approach, businesses can leverage its powerful inventory management, order processing, and fulfillment capabilities, all while benefiting from the flexibility and customization offered by headless commerce. The result is a future-proof eCommerce solution that can grow and adapt alongside your business, driving efficiency, scalability, and customer satisfaction.

If you would like to get a deep look at the SkuNexus platform and learn how it can help optimize your headless commerce operations, please contact our team at your convenience to schedule a live demo.

Benefits of Headless Commerce

Composable Commerce

Distributed Order Management

Headless Commerce Platform

Headless Commerce Solution

Headless Commerce Solutions

Headless Commerce

Unified Commerce

Unified Commerce Platform

What is Distributed Order Management

What is Headless Commerce

 

Person typing on a computer

Schedule a Personalized Demo

Let us show you how our platform can elevate your operations.